Should You Buy a 2021 Kawasaki Z650?
The 2021 Kawasaki Z650 is a naked bike that offers a perfect blend of performance and practicality for both new and experienced riders. With a 649cc engine producing 67 horsepower and 48 lb-ft of torque, this bike delivers a spirited ride while maintaining excellent fuel efficiency, boasting an impressive 53 MPG combined. Its lightweight design and agile handling make it ideal for urban commuting and spirited weekend rides alike. While the MSRP and specific transmission details are not available, the Z650 is known for its approachable ergonomics and rider-friendly features, making it a versatile choice in the naked bike segment.
The ideal buyer for the 2021 Kawasaki Z650 is a rider looking for a fun, versatile motorcycle that excels in urban environments and weekend adventures, appealing to both new and experienced enthusiasts.
